Transaction 8651ff4eea3dbc63522f6233ca81e600d2cdc2103a5c7c71dd5736f51cd8988e
1 Input
1 Output
-
8651ff4eea3dbc63522f6233ca81e600d2cdc2103a5c7c71dd5736f51cd8988e:0
- value
- 31603872
- script pubkey
- OP_0 OP_PUSHBYTES_20 23bec8a79ec596bc2747ed4a5ff53a45efac890c
- address
- ltc1qywlv3fu7ckttcf68a499laf6ghh6ezgvtrllgz